Understanding Gold Stocks

Gold stocks are typically categorized into three main types:

  1. Junior Exploration Stocks: These companies are involved in the exploration and development of new gold mines. They often have high growth potential but also carry higher risks due to the uncertainty of discovering and developing a profitable mine.

  2. Intermediate Gold Stocks: These companies are usually involved in the development and production of gold mines. They offer a balance between growth potential and stability.

  3. Senior Gold Stocks: These companies are well-established and produce a significant amount of gold. They tend to offer more stability and lower growth potential compared to junior and intermediate stocks.

Benefits of Investing in Gold Stocks

  • Hedge Against Inflation: Gold is often seen as a hedge against inflation. When the value of the dollar declines, gold typically increases in value, protecting your investment.

  • Diversification: Including gold stocks in your portfolio can help reduce overall risk. Gold often performs differently than other asset classes, such as stocks and bonds.

  • Potential for High Returns: While gold stocks may not offer the same level of stability as senior gold stocks, they can provide higher returns, especially if the company successfully discovers and develops a new gold mine.

Risks of Investing in Gold Stocks

  • Market Volatility: Gold prices can be highly volatile, which can lead to significant fluctuations in the value of gold stocks.

  • Operational Risks: Mining companies face various operational risks, including geological uncertainties, environmental concerns, and regulatory challenges.

  • Political and Economic Risks: Mining operations in certain countries may be subject to political instability, economic sanctions, and other risks that can impact the company's performance.

Key Factors to Consider When Investing in Gold Stocks

  • Company Financials: Analyze the company's financial statements, including revenue, expenses, and profitability.

  • Management Team: Research the background and experience of the company's management team.

  • Gold Reserves and Production: Evaluate the company's gold reserves and production capabilities.

  • Market Trends: Stay informed about market trends and economic indicators that can impact gold prices.
